SavingsPlanOrder interface
Interface representing a SavingsPlanOrder.
Methods
elevate(string, Savings |
Elevate as owner on savings plan order based on billing permissions. |
get(string, Savings |
Get a savings plan order. |
list(Savings |
List all Savings plan orders. |
Method Details
elevate(string, SavingsPlanOrderElevateOptionalParams)
Elevate as owner on savings plan order based on billing permissions.
function elevate(savingsPlanOrderId: string, options?: SavingsPlanOrderElevateOptionalParams): Promise<RoleAssignmentEntity>
Parameters
- savingsPlanOrderId
-
string
Order ID of the savings plan
The options parameters.
Returns
Promise<RoleAssignmentEntity>
get(string, SavingsPlanOrderGetOptionalParams)
Get a savings plan order.
function get(savingsPlanOrderId: string, options?: SavingsPlanOrderGetOptionalParams): Promise<SavingsPlanOrderModel>
Parameters
- savingsPlanOrderId
-
string
Order ID of the savings plan
The options parameters.
Returns
Promise<SavingsPlanOrderModel>
list(SavingsPlanOrderListOptionalParams)
List all Savings plan orders.
function list(options?: SavingsPlanOrderListOptionalParams): PagedAsyncIterableIterator<SavingsPlanOrderModel, SavingsPlanOrderModel[], PageSettings>
Parameters
The options parameters.